Output 74307380037577c88e3c1373f3e4663eff71ef150f30cd7cd706ed68162391b4:0

value
1000900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ec703e615784a6e0178a8ac1fca225115f146fe4 OP_EQUALVERIFY OP_CHECKSIG
address
1NZAw6kLUftFK97xqaWCLrVQSkisxk2q8H
transaction
74307380037577c88e3c1373f3e4663eff71ef150f30cd7cd706ed68162391b4
spent
true